TURN-208: Gatevale turnstile counters at the Merrow Field pilot double-count when a rotation reverses mid-cycle. Attendance totals drift roughly 2% high per event. The debounce window fix is implemented, reviewed by Ilsa, and soak-tested across two simulated match days without drift. Ready for your cut; the candidate build is identified below.

trace token, tagag-tafog: htk6_5ed18c

## Deployment — Marrowbay query planner regression

For the weekly sync: the planner regression introduced in release 7.3 is mitigated by pinning the old cost model at deploy time. Slow aggregate queries dropped back to baseline after the pin. The pin stays until upstream ships a fix. Deployments must carry the following settings.

service settings:
novath:
  pin: 1396
  tenant: pelys
  seal: seal_ccc035e1
  metrics_host: metrics.novath.qorvelworks.test
  standby_team: fraeth
  escalation: drueth-zorok
  nonce: 61d508

## Deployment: Formula Sandboxing

Quick heads-up before you approve this: Quillbox lets users submit their own spreadsheet-style formulas, and we run every one of them inside the Fenwick sandbox rather than the main worker process. Nothing user-supplied ever touches the filesystem or network — the evaluator gets a frozen interpreter with a hard CPU budget and a memory cap. If a formula blows either limit, we kill it and return a friendly error. The sandbox limits applied in production are listed below.

config for tagep-yajef:
ulawyn:
  log_level: error
  metrics_host: metrics.ulawyn.lumiclabs.internal
  pin: 0564
  pool_size: 32

### Escalation — telemetry payload compression

If the Packrat compressor falls behind (queue depth > 10k or ratio drops below 2:1), do not disable compression; downstream Beaconview ingestion will reject oversized payloads. First: restart the compressor pods, check dictionary version drift between producers and the Packrat sidecar. If drift confirmed, roll producers back one version. Persisting beyond 30 minutes is a page-worthy incident owned by the Ingest team. Escalate unresolved cases to the address below.

escalation mailbox, bafog-fafog: ulador@paliqlabs.internal